{"product_id":"9781908947208","title":"Ingne Dearga Dheaideo","description":"\u003cp\u003eIngne Dearga Dheaideo has the variety that readers have come to expect of a Pádraic Breathnach collection of short stories. The opening story, Anam Mná, explores the plight of a mother mourning the loss of her first-born child, and brilliantly captures her devastation and disbelief at what has happened. Iníon describes a father's anxious wait for the return of his wayward teenage daughter from a night out. M'Uncail Máirtín agus Cailleacha Mheiriceá is a wonderful, parable-like tale of two witches in Manhattan who engage in a fierce stone-throwing battle. The author explores a wide range of themes in this collection, including grief, old age, the eternal struggle between tradition and modernity and life through the eyes of a child.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Cló lar-Chonnacht","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":47137377091824,"sku":"9781908947208","price":7.49,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0737\/7593\/9824\/files\/9781908947208_p0.jpg?v=1763622670","url":"https:\/\/shop-qa.barnesandnoble.com\/products\/9781908947208","provider":"Barnes \u0026 Noble (DEV)","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
